服务器上配置环境变量的命令,服务器上配置环境变量
- 综合资讯
- 2024-09-28 23:48:18
- 5

服务器上配置环境变量是一项重要且常见的操作。其目的在于为服务器上的应用程序提供必要的运行环境。通过特定的命令来完成这一过程。这些命令可能因服务器的操作系统不同而有所差异...
在服务器上配置环境变量通常需要使用特定的命令。这些命令的具体语法和参数可能因服务器的操作系统和环境而有所不同。配置环境变量的目的是为了让服务器能够找到和使用特定的软件、工具或库。通过设置环境变量,可以将相关的路径添加到系统的搜索路径中,使得服务器在运行程序时能够正确地找到所需的文件和依赖项。在配置环境变量时,需要注意权限和安全性问题,确保只有授权的用户能够访问和修改环境变量。还需要根据实际情况进行合理的配置,以满足服务器的需求。
服务器上配置环境变量的详细指南
一、引言
在服务器环境中,配置环境变量是一项重要的任务,环境变量可以帮助我们在不同的应用程序和脚本中方便地访问和使用特定的路径、参数和配置信息,本文将详细介绍在服务器上配置环境变量的步骤和相关注意事项。
二、环境变量的作用
环境变量在服务器环境中具有以下几个重要作用:
1、方便访问:通过设置环境变量,我们可以在命令行中直接使用变量名来代替完整的路径或参数,提高了操作的便利性。
2、跨应用程序共享:环境变量可以在多个应用程序和脚本中共享,使得不同的程序可以访问相同的配置信息。
3、提高可维护性:将配置信息存储在环境变量中,使得配置的修改更加方便,只需修改环境变量的值,而不需要在每个应用程序中进行修改。
4、安全性:环境变量可以用于存储敏感信息,如密码、数据库连接字符串等,通过适当的权限设置,可以提高系统的安全性。
三、服务器上配置环境变量的命令
不同的操作系统和服务器环境可能使用不同的命令来配置环境变量,以下是一些常见的命令:
1、Windows 服务器:
setx
:用于设置用户级环境变量。
set
:用于查看当前环境变量。
regedit
:用于编辑系统级环境变量。
2、Linux 服务器:
export
:用于设置用户级环境变量。
env
:用于查看当前环境变量。
/etc/profile
:用于设置系统级环境变量。
四、配置环境变量的步骤
以下是在 Windows 服务器上配置环境变量的步骤:
1、打开命令提示符窗口。
2、使用setx
命令设置环境变量,要设置一个名为MY_VARIABLE
的环境变量,其值为C:\myfolder
,可以使用以下命令:
```
setx MY_VARIABLE "C:\myfolder"
```
3、要查看当前环境变量,可以使用set
命令。
4、如果要设置系统级环境变量,需要使用regedit
命令打开注册表编辑器,找到H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ment
键,然后在右侧窗口中添加或修改环境变量。
以下是在 Linux 服务器上配置环境变量的步骤:
1、打开终端窗口。
2、使用export
命令设置环境变量,要设置一个名为MY_VARIABLE
的环境变量,其值为/myfolder
,可以使用以下命令:
```
export MY_VARIABLE=/myfolder
```
3、要查看当前环境变量,可以使用env
命令。
4、如果要设置系统级环境变量,需要编辑/etc/profile
文件,在文件末尾添加或修改环境变量,要设置一个名为MY_VARIABLE
的环境变量,其值为/myfolder
,可以在/etc/profile
文件中添加以下行:
```
export MY_VARIABLE=/myfolder
```
然后保存并关闭文件,最后使用source /etc/profile
命令使修改生效。
五、注意事项
在配置环境变量时,需要注意以下几点:
1、环境变量名应该具有描述性,以便于理解其用途。
2、环境变量的值应该是正确的路径或参数,确保应用程序能够正确访问。
3、在设置系统级环境变量时,需要具有管理员权限。
4、如果修改了环境变量,可能需要重新启动应用程序或服务器才能使修改生效。
5、环境变量的作用域不同,用户级环境变量只在当前用户的会话中有效,而系统级环境变量在整个服务器系统中有效。
六、总结
配置环境变量是服务器管理中的一项重要任务,通过合理地设置环境变量,可以提高系统的可维护性和可扩展性,方便应用程序的部署和管理,本文详细介绍了在 Windows 和 Linux 服务器上配置环境变量的命令和步骤,并提供了一些注意事项,希望本文能够帮助读者更好地理解和掌握服务器上配置环境变量的方法。
本文链接:https://www.zhitaoyun.cn/21750.html
发表评论